Laid-Off Worker Gets Asked To Return After Holiday Rush Sends Their Old Job Into Panic Mode

Every now and then, you find a work story on Reddit that perfectly captures the “I dodged a bullet” feeling. This person spent years going above and beyond at a small diner, only to get laid off in July for “budget cuts.” Fast-forward a few months, and they’re thriving at a better job with higher pay, benefits, and coworkers who don’t treat them like the office handyman.

Then Thanksgiving week hit the diner like a wrecking ball, and suddenly the old boss was calling, asking if they could come back. It’s a wild turn, and Reddit had plenty of thoughts on how to handle it politely.
